A Global Certificate Course in Electric Vehicles (EVs) provides comprehensive training on the design, manufacturing, and operation of electric vehicles. The program is meticulously structured to equip participants with the necessary skills for a thriving career in this rapidly expanding sector.
Learning outcomes typically include a strong understanding of EV battery technologies (including lithium-ion batteries and solid-state batteries), power electronics, motor drives, and charging infrastructure. Participants gain hands-on experience with EV components and systems through simulations and, where available, practical sessions. The curriculum often covers relevant legislation and safety standards, enhancing the overall learning experience.
The duration of a Global Certificate Course in EVs varies depending on the institution and intensity of the program, ranging from a few weeks for intensive short courses to several months for more in-depth options. Flexibility is often built into the course design to cater to working professionals.

Why this course?
Global Certificate Courses in Electric Vehicles (EVs) are increasingly significant in today's rapidly evolving automotive market. The UK, a key player in the global EV transition, saw a surge in EV registrations, reaching 190,727 in 2022, representing 16.6% of the new car market, according to the Society of Motor Manufacturers and Traders (SMMT). This growth underscores the urgent need for skilled professionals in EV design, manufacturing, maintenance, and sales. A comprehensive EV certificate course equips learners with the theoretical knowledge and practical skills necessary to contribute to this booming sector.
